Studio Backdrops: A Guide to Muslin, Paint, and Texture

Selecting the perfect scene for your photo studio can feel tricky, but understanding the available options is crucial. Muslin backdrops remain a popular choice, prized for their versatility and ability to be dyed . Alternatively, you can produce truly distinctive looks using painted backdrops, allowing for custom artistic expression. For adding dimension , consider textured backdrops - these can be achieved through various techniques like fabric manipulation, unique paint applications, or even the incorporation of physical materials. Finally , the most suitable choice depends on your unique style and budget .

Mottled Muslin Magic

Achieving realistic appearances in your picture backdrops can appear daunting, but aged muslin offers a easy solution. This technique mimics the organic beauty of vintage fabrics, adding a feeling of depth and charm to your scenes. By deliberately manipulating the fabric and employing subtle hue variations, you can develop a setting that beautifully complements your subject . Playing with different degrees of mottling will reveal a world of creative possibilities.

Transforming the Empty Backdrop to a breathtaking Amazing Scene : Stage Planning Suggestions

Creating a visually striking backdrop doesn't have to be complicated. Consider beyond just sheet; the possibilities are limitless ! You can construct atmosphere and set the mood of your event with careful planning and inventive design. Here are a few ideas to inspire you:

  • Cloth : Draping fabric in diverse textures and hues can produce a gentle and opulent feel.
  • Nature Elements: Incorporate stems, foliage , or flowers for an country or charming aesthetic.
  • Geometric Patterns: Employ bold lines and figures for the and eye-catching look.
  • Illumination : Strategic lighting can dramatically alter the appearance of the backdrop, creating depth and highlighting key details.

Remember to consistently factor in the complete theme and intent of any event when choosing your backdrop style .
